Output b85a689ef3d08655603bcd37ec871282c7f2f84ba68a0d1eb942c0aa3aee76fe:0

value
2124850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 795bf2d645f6d8267ebad9054293e0f56165cb0d OP_EQUAL
address
3CkhqTKvPH29UDVTBGZyEmE2X8bdhRcPFq
transaction
b85a689ef3d08655603bcd37ec871282c7f2f84ba68a0d1eb942c0aa3aee76fe
spent
true